About Ricardo Hernandez, Sfo

As the Chief Financial Officer (CFO) for Tucson Unified School District (TUSD1), I oversee the financial activities and operations of a $750+ million budget that supports teaching and learning for over 42,000 students and 8,000 employees. I have more than 20 years of experience in finance, accounting, and management in the education and non-profit sectors.My core competencies include strategic financial planning, budgeting and forecasting, grants management, policy development, and compliance. I advise the superintendent and school board on the financial and budget matters of the district, and ensure the finances are administered in accordance with federal, state, and local laws. I also lead and mentor a team of finance professionals, and collaborate with internal and external stakeholders to achieve the district's goals and mission. I am passionate about providing quality education and opportunities for all students, and leveraging my financial expertise to support and enhance the district's programs and services.

  • Tucson Unified School District (Tusd1.Org)
    Budget Coordinator
    Tucson Unified School District (Tusd1.Org) Jul 2008 - Oct 2008
    Tucson, Arizona, Us
    My role, although brief, as a Budget Coordinator in the largest school district outside the Phoenix metropolitan area required an ability of coordinating activities and functions related to the proper implementation of a $500 million annual budget at varying levels of the organization. With over 100 schools and almost two dozen administrative departments, the interaction between the needs of a school and the views of administration tend to move in different directions. My role was to try to work as a “middle man” to ensure that the communication between school-based decision making was included as part of the decision making on a district-wide basis. It required understanding how the organization worked from senior management levels to local school levels. It demanded that I understand how to communicate the right information to the appropriate individuals in order to make sound, data-drive decisions. Due to the complex nature of how variable sources of funding interacted towards one goal of ensuring the education of a student, I was responsible for establishing processes the ensured those goals were met while also targeting funds appropriately. I was required to recommend and establish processes and procedures that monitor major federal grant budgets, use of resources that aligned with federally mandated desegregation orders, and ensure compliance with State mandates on uses of state budget support. These elements also demanded that I understand the senior management’s mission and direction for ensuring funds were targeted towards accomplishing that mission. Understanding how to synthesize expenditures into a qualitative analysis was paramount to my work. Being able to “tell the story” from the numbers is what mattered the most to individuals who had to make decisions not always knowing the intricacies of the financial operations of the organization.
